There are several versions of these, mine were with the side shooters. I pulled them off recently. Two reasons: they tensed to howl when mounted on the DV8 brackets; a biredd cop pulled me over for them not being covered, and it turns out that it is impossible to buy covers for them. The AuxBeams are marginally more expensive and a better product IMO.

Just want to throw this on here... i was using 3 10amps aux switches for low/high/amber but the 10amps cannot handle high beam, fuse blown twice. I switched it to the 15amps and no issue the last few time i tested.
Per description in the manual: low is 65w and high is 95w
